Report: NCCU student found dead in May was sick, throwing up
A North Carolina Central University student who was found dead in his dorm room on May 3 was feeling sick and throwing up the night before his roommate found him unresponsive, according to the medical examiner's report.

Kewanne Malik Lee, 22, was a junior at the school and was studying Health Education. The medical examiner's report said Lee had gone to lie down in his room on May 2 after he had been sick.
Investigators found a box of insulin, unused syringes and a glucometer in Lee's room, according to the report. Lee's pediatrician had been treating him for diabetes.
